Responsibilities
- Coordinate the daily activities of the Production Department, ensuring production operations are carried out following all established procedures, in a safe and efficient manner, and in conformance to plant quality standards.
- Assist in setting priorities and adherence to schedule.
- Monitor all production activities to ensure procedures are followed, redirecting as necessary.
- Complete and communicate incident reports for all incidents/accidents/near misses that occur on shift.
- Enforce plant housekeeping standards.
- Authorize all safety permits as required.
- Act as incident commander in times of emergency until management arrives (Emergency Operations Officer).
- Coordinate necessary resources as required to safe and efficient operations.
- Verify payroll punches are correct for each shift.
- Arrange vacation, overtime, and fire watch for each shift.
- Coordinate all group training.
- Ensure all paperwork and records are complete and accurate.
- Ensure empty containers are properly handled, labeled and stored.
- Communicate and coordinate maintenance activities to meet production needs.
- Communicate/coordinate plant operations with production scheduling and Lab technicians.
- Develop, update, and communicate the daily operating plan.
- Review procedure updates/MOCs/communication bulletins with the shift.
- Forward feedback to and from the shift as necessary.
- Notify Plant Manager, Maintenance Manager, and Material Manager of production and maintenance issues or delays.
- Review with Maintenance Manager any related project, process, and maintenance costs to the overall benefit of the company.
- Provide leadership to move from a reactionary repair mode to proactive work and scheduling.
- Assist maintenance to sustain and improve maintenance management and PM systems while moving the production department toward operator-led basic maintenance and monitoring activities.
Safety
- Represent Syensqo by reinforcing plant and corporate values and maintaining a safe, healthy, and environmentally sound workplace.
- Administer all safety policies and procedures for productions activities.
- Participate in required safety activities and inspections.
- Authorize and audit safety permits as required and participate in the Plant Behavioral Based Safety program.
- Complete reports for incidents, accidents, and near misses; respond to emergencies; conduct regular safety meetings; and ensure compliance with safety rules and procedures.
- Conduct periodic inspections to ensure compliance with process safety rules and evaluate risk reduction activities.
You will bring
- Engineering degree with 5+ years industrial experience including team leadership and group management in a chemical facility.
- Additional educational background may be substituted for experience.
- Knowledge and ability to perform tasks required of the Production Technician job responsibilities.
- Basic troubleshooting abilities to identify causes of production equipment and process upsets.
- Basic PC skills for electronic communications, CMMS maintenance work orders, incident reporting, and data retrieval (SDS).
- Ability to coach, council, and motivate subordinates constructively.
- Strong communication with peers, subordinates, and superiors; ability to train staff in Production Technician responsibilities.
